Abstract
The utility model relates to a multifunctional universal seabed base. A fairing is arranged on a disc seat body; a floating ball cabin and an instrument cabin are arranged in the fairing; a universal pod and a hanging frame for carrying instruments are arranged in the instrument cabin; a sensor is arranged on the hanging frame; a bracket is arranged in the instrument cabin; an acoustic releaser is fixed on the bracket; lifting holes are formed in the fairing; water-permeable putting and recovering columns are arranged on the disc seat body; and the upper ends of the water-permeable putting and recovering columns are positioned at the lifting holes. The acoustic communication function of the seabed base is mainly expanded, the compatibility of the seabed base to the conventional sensors from different manufacturers and of different specifications is enhanced, and the multifunctional universal seabed base can be used as a high-assurance platform for monitoring underwater marine environment in real time.

Background technology
The sea bed base is the observation system of throwing in the seabed, mainly carries various instruments and surveys near the ocean environment parameter in seabed, also can adopt the sectional parameter of acoustical instrument Measuring Oceanic environment.Along with being widely used of sea bed base, there are two problems outstanding day by day.Problem be along with marine environmental protection, Oceanic disasters are emergent and the development in field such as marine scientific research, the ocean real time monitoring is had higher requirement, particularly to the functional requirement of submarine observation platform sea bed base data real-time Transmission.Present domestic sea bed based platform is mostly in conceptual phase, and it is extremely low and lack the practical business application verification to be recycled into power, and the design of sea bed base function is more single, has only the design of flow measurement function mostly, lacks the function design of data in real time transmission; Another problem is the unusual disunity of instrument size of sensor different manufacturers such as present marine environment investigation instrument ADCP, thermohaline, different size; Cause existing sea bed base compatibility very poor; A kind of sea bed base can only be installed the sensor of one a type of sensor or a producer, influences user's practical application greatly and has increased user's use cost.Therefore how expanding the function of sea bed base and the compatibility of enhancing sea bed base will be the key that can the sea bed base be promoted the use of.

The specific embodiment
The multifunctional universal formula sea bed based structures of the utility model is as depicted in figs. 1 and 2, and this sea bed base comprises fairing 2, instrument compartment 9 and dish pedestal 1 three parts, on the dish pedestal 1 fairing 2 is installed; Fairing 2 inside are provided with ball float cabin 3 and instrument compartment 9, and ball float cabin 9 is used to install ball float 4, are provided with universal gondola 8 in the instrument compartment 9 and are used to carry the suspension member frame 5 that instrument is used; The universal gondola 8 inner ADCP that install, sensor 6 is installed on the suspension member frame 5, is provided with support in the instrument compartment 9; Acoustics releaser 12 is fixed on the support; Fairing 2 is provided with three lifting hole(eyelet)s 14 and four attacker holes, on the dish pedestal 1 permeable input is installed and reclaims post 7, and permeable input is reclaimed post 7 upper ends and is positioned at lifting hole(eyelet) 14 places; Also be provided with sacrificial anode 15 and two lifting appliances 10 on the dish pedestal 1, instrument compartment 9 is provided with cardo ring.Rope cabin 11 and battery flat 13 also are installed on the dish pedestal 1.The dish pedestal does not have the 316L stainless steel sheet of the weldering of connecing for putting in order the plate manufacturing, is furnished with three permeable inputs and reclaims posts 7, DL# sacrificial anode 15.
The logical function of sound of sea bed base has mainly been expanded in the design of multifunctional universal formula sea bed base, and has strengthened the compatibility of sea bed base to existing different manufacturers different size sensor.Still kept simultaneously the anti-design advantage that adsorbs sea bed base and the anti-alluvial of self-balancing sea bed base of self-balancing, thrown in like multiple equilibrium and can guarantee can not occur under the bigger situation of sea bed base flow velocity in launch process rollover or inclination; The porous design can guarantee that launch process has the hauling rope of multi-angle to select; Instrument compartment is furnished with cardo ring can make the ADCP of lift-launch pop one's head in vertically upward; Permeable post design can reduce adsorption affinity, is beneficial to the recovery of sea bed base in mud matter seabed; Dish pedestal and instrument compartment material all adopt the 316L corrosion-resistant steel, and are furnished with the DL# sacrificial anode and can guarantee that the sea bed base uses under water throughout the year; Instrument compartment can carry many essential sensors such as thermohaline; Instrument compartment adopts four base location, can guarantee that displacement can not appear in instrument compartment in launch process.Multifunctional universal formula sea bed base is through repeatedly experiment improvement, and can be used as under water, the environment real time monitoring high platform that ensures in ocean uses.
This multifunctional universal formula sea bed base package program is following:
(1) ADCP is fixed on the universal gondola 8 in the instrument compartment 9;
(2) thermohaline sensor 6 or Other Instruments are fixed on the suspension member frame 5 in the instrument compartment 9;
(3) acoustics releaser 12 is fixed on the support on the instrument compartment 9;
(4) ball float 4 is connected DYNEEMA ball float rope, the ball float rope other end connects the lifting appliance on the body 1 of sitting crosslegged, and ball float 4 is contained in the ball float cabin 3;
(5) fairing 2 is fixed on the body 1 of sitting crosslegged.
This multifunctional universal formula sea bed base input program is following:
(1) pass three permeable inputs with three with the DYNEEMA rope and reclaim post 7, double end is connected on the acoustics releaser;
(2) the acoustics releaser is fixed on input rope one end, throws in rope and is wrapped on the winch;
(3) pass two permeable inputs recovery post 7, one ends with a hauling rope and fix, the other end is semifixed;
(4) with the lifting appliance on the ship 10 the sea bed base is hung the deck, slowly throw in to the seabed;
(5) the sea bed base is released order by the transmission of unit, deck behind the seabed, and the acoustics releaser breaks off relations, and throws in rope and the disengaging of sea bed base, reclaims the acoustics releaser through throwing in rope.
This multifunctional universal formula sea bed base reclaimer is following:
(1) after the recovery ship arrives release position, released order by the transmission of unit, deck, the acoustics releaser 12 in the sea bed base breaks off relations, and ball float emerges;
(2) reclaim ship near ball float 4, untie the DYNEEMA ball float rope on the ball float 4, slowly reclaim the sea bed base through DYNEEMA ball float rope.
